Calacatta Gold Marble vs. Italian Carrara Stone : What’s the Contrast?
While both Calacatta Gold and Italian Carrara rock originate from Italy, they present distinct differences. Carrara typically features a white background and subtle gray patterns , offering a traditional look. Calacatta Gold, on the other hand, is famed for its luxurious amber veining upon a softer white base . The appearance of striking gold veins is what essentially sets Calacatta Gold distinctively and makes it read more considerably more costly than Carrara. Essentially , think of Carrara as the more choice, while Calacatta Gold offers a luxurious and dramatic aesthetic.

Protecting The Calacatta Gold Marble
To maintain these beautiful Calacatta Gold marble areas looking their most best, routine care is vital . Avoid using abrasive products like lemon juice or vinegar, as they can damage the gorgeous stone. Instead, choose a pH-neutral stone solution and warm water. Immediately wipe up any liquids – especially those containing coffee – to prevent marking. Consider sealing your marble annually to provide an extra layer against damage .
The Allure of Calacatta Gold Marble: A Buyer's Guide
Calacatta premium marble has captivated homeowners and architects alike, and it's not difficult to understand why. Its rare stone is renowned for its stunning beauty, featuring a bright background layered with prominent golden streaks. Acquiring authentic Calacatta Gold isn’t always a simple process, so this guide will offer you with important information. Consider these points before choosing your buy:
- Quarry Origin: True Calacatta Gold comes from the Apuan Alps in Italy. Be cautious of fakes from other areas .
- Veining Patterns: Each piece is one-of-a-kind , so review several options to find the ideal match for your project .
- Pricing: Expect a significant investment, as this stone is a highly sought-after luxury material.
- Maintenance: Like all natural stone, it requires periodic sealing and mild cleaning.
